The Growth of Online Gaming

The origins of online gaming date back to the 1990s, when the advent of the internet enabled players to connect with others across the globe. Early multiplayer games like Doom and Warcraft paved the way for more sophisticated and expansive online worlds. Today, online gaming spans genres, including first-person shooters, role-playing games, strategy games, and multiplayer battle arenas, with games like Fortnite, League of Legends, and Call of Duty dominating the industry.

Advancements in technology have made online gaming more accessible and engaging. The widespread availability of high-speed internet, alongside the development of powerful gaming consoles, PCs, and mobile devices, has made it easier for players to join games anytime, anywhere. Cloud gaming, which allows players to stream games without the need for high-end hardware, has further expanded the reach of online gaming.

Economic Impact

The online gaming industry has become a multi-billion-dollar global market. It is not only a source of entertainment for millions of players but also a thriving industry with a variety of career opportunities. Professional esports, where players compete in tournaments for cash prizes, has gained massive popularity, with games like Dota 2 and Overwatch offering prize pools that rival traditional sports events.

Streaming platforms like Twitch and YouTube have created new avenues for gamers to earn money by broadcasting their gameplay and engaging with audiences. Content creators, influencers, and streamers have become celebrities in their own right, with millions of followers. The gaming industry has also given rise to a variety of related businesses, such as game development studios, esports teams, merchandise, and online gaming services.

Challenges and Concerns

Despite its many benefits, online gaming is not without its challenges and concerns. One of the most pressing issues is the potential for addiction. With the immersive nature of many games and the rise of loot boxes and microtransactions, some players may find it difficult to balance gaming with other aspects of their lives. It is important for individuals to set healthy boundaries and practice responsible gaming.

Another concern is the prevalence of toxic behavior within gaming communities. Online anonymity can sometimes lead to harassment, bullying, and other forms of disruptive behavior, which can make the gaming experience less enjoyable for others. Many developers are taking steps to combat this issue by implementing moderation tools, reporting systems, and promoting positive in-game environments.

The Future of Online Gaming

Looking ahead, the future of online gaming seems bright. The integration of virtual reality (VR) and augmented reality (AR) promises to make gaming even more immersive. Cloud gaming, with its ability to stream games directly to a wide range of devices, will continue to make gaming more accessible. Moreover, the ongoing evolution of artificial intelligence (AI) will lead to smarter NPCs (non-playable characters) and more dynamic game worlds.
